Amazon Bedrock AgentCore Runtime now supports shell command execution
News
This article announces that Amazon Bedrock AgentCore Runtime now supports shell command execution through a new InvokeAgentRuntimeCommand API.
- New API enables direct shell command execution within AgentCore Runtime sessions
- Commands stream output in real time over HTTP/2 with exit code returns
- Eliminates need for custom command execution logic in containers
- Commands run in same container, filesystem, and environment as agent session
- Supports concurrent execution with agent invocations without blocking
- Available across fourteen AWS regions globally
This feature simplifies AI agent workflows by providing platform-level command execution for deterministic operations like testing, dependency installation, and git commands.
